Embodiment 1

[0031] The femoral neck two-way compression distance-limited sliding screw of embodiment one:

[0032] Such as figure 1 and figure 2 As shown, the femoral neck bidirectional compression distance-limited sliding screw according to the embodiment of the present invention includes an inner core 11 , an outer sleeve 21 and a connection part arranged at the tail of the outer sleeve 21 . Wherein, the head of the inner core 11 is provided with a first external thread 13, and the tail of the outer sleeve 21 is provided with a second external thread 22, and the pitch of the second external thread 22 is different from that of the first external thread 13. It should be noted that the head and tail orientation It is based on the orientation or positional relationship shown in the drawings, and should not be construed as limiting the present invention.

Abstract

The invention discloses a femoral neck bidirectional pressurizing distance-limiting sliding screw and a screwdriver, and relates to the technical field of medical instruments. The femoral neck bidirectional pressurizing distance-limiting sliding screw comprises an inner core, wherein the head of the inner core is provided with a first external thread; an outer sleeve, wherein the tail of the outer sleeve is provided with a second external thread, the thread pitch of the second external thread is different from that of the first external thread, the tail of the inner core is connected with the head of the outer sleeve through a connecting structure and can slide relative to the axial direction, and the outer sleeve is provided with a distance limiting structure to limit the relative sliding distance between the inner core and the outer sleeve; and a connecting part, which is arranged at the tail of the outer sleeve. The first external thread of the inner core and the second external thread of the outer sleeve can enable the fracture end of the femoral neck to play a bidirectional pressurizing role in the process of entering the proximal femur through the double-thread structure, and the stability of the fracture end is improved.

Description

technical field [0001] The invention relates to the technical field of medical instruments, in particular to a femoral neck two-way compressive distance-limited sliding screw, and also relates to a screwdriver. Background technique [0002] Currently, femoral neck fractures account for 3.85% of adult fractures. It is a common fracture that can occur in all age groups. Nonunion and avascular necrosis of the femoral head after femoral neck fractures have always been difficult in trauma orthopedic treatment. At present, the hip-preserving treatment of femoral neck fractures is still controversial. Different internal fixation devices for femoral neck fractures have emerged in the domestic and foreign markets, which is enough to show that the internal fixation devices for femoral neck fractures are still not perfect.
